  • Full-time Job Summary We are seeking a dynamic and organized Office Adminisrator to oversee the daily operations of our Ocala outpatient mental health clinic.
This full-time position offers comprehensive benefits. The ideal candidate will bring enthusiasm, strong leadership skills, and a passion for supporting mental health services to create an efficient and welcoming environment for staff and clients alike. Your proactive approach will help foster a positive workplace culture while maintaining operational excellence. Duties Oversee and support all administrative responsibilities to ensure the office is operating smoothly. This includes handling all incoming calls, visitors that come into the office, as well as dailey e-mails and voicemails sending correspondence, as needed. Provide support for day-to-day operations under the Program Manager to ensure therapist/clinicians are providing quality services and meeting contractual Medicaid and commercial funder guidelines. Daily review of the electronic health record (EHR) dashboard to assure compliance. Communicate/follow-up with clinicians/therapist/mental health professionals on compliance related issues via e-mail/telephone. Review reports and work with clinicians/therapist/mental health professionals on improvements, as needed. Responsible for electronically sending/scanning/uploading Treatment Plan Reviews (TPR). Responsible for ordering monthly supply orders for the office (making sure all supplies are kept on hand). Responsible for maintaining daily office needs to include troubleshooting copiers, faxes, phones, setting up for meetings/functions, etc. Represent the office as the health and safety officer and complete drills and site inspections.
